Q: Is 2,479,516 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,479,516 is a composite number.

Why is 2,479,516 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,479,516 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 13 26 41 52 82 164 533 1,066 1,163 2,132 2,326 4,652 15,119 30,238 47,683 60,476 95,366 190,732 619,879 1,239,758 and 2,479,516, with no remainder.

Since 2,479,516 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,479,516, it is a composite number.
